the readymades - i'm a man, i'm a flower

THE READYMADES are a lost chapter in the unruly punk history of sacramento, california......but thanks to MT ST MTN that doesn't have to be the case anymore.....they've recently issued I'M A MAN, I'M A FLOWER, the forever shelved album from THE READYMADES recorded way back in 2001......  super limited and rowdy, this is one lp you ought to rush out to the record store to grab now.........

nofi garage punk doesn't get any better than I'M A MAN, I'M A FLOWER..... hopped up on black flag, the sonics, the stooges, the kinks and the gories, THE READYMADES rocket through some of the best unhinged distorto punk madness you'll come across ....... this is of course to be expected if you know anything about rich haley, charles albright and/or chris woodhouse, whose other projects bear a close resemblance to the READYMADES.......

band history is sparse (no internet presence at all), 
so here's the details direct from the source.....
according to MT ST MTN -

13 tracks of blown-out, lo-fi garage punk blast that walks a tight-rope between intentional organized chaos and a car careening off a bridge. Recorded over a decade ago in the legendary Loft space by Chris Woodhouse (Mayyors, Karate Party), this record got shelved as the band imploded and members went on to more stable projects - Rich Haley forming the Duchess Of Saigon (S-S Records) and Charles Albright forming and unforming a million projects since then, including his highly regarded recent solo output (S-S Records, Permanent Records). Greg Ginn joins the early Kinks and borrows Henry's Dress' equipment to do covers off the first Redd Kross record. Howling cave-stomp punk with film of chattering white noise and the best of the Woodhouse treatment. Get yourself a hat and hold on to it.

charles albright - the first four years tape

If it takes a cassette to gather all the psych pummeling madness of CHARLES ALBRIGHT into one place, so be it. The First Four Years would be recommended even if it came out on just 8 track. Charles Albright's under the radar garage punk noise making has gone very under appreciated by many, but maybe this collection of way out of print singles can change that. Here's the scoop from Sacramento Records:

"CHARLES ALBRIGHT has been a fixture in Sacramento's underground punk scene for over a decade. Chances are the only band of Charles' that you've heard is THE PIZZAS, but he has been in a ton of them (all of them awesome and so under the radar.) This cassette features his various singles released on labels like S.S., Permanent and Goodbye Boozy. No bullshit psych punk that still lurks in the garage and has great over-blown guitar that sounds like young Charles has soaked up plenty Leigh Stephens and Greg Ginn, which he has."

Yes and add to that crazed drive of those old Rip Offs records, the feedback buzz of the Wipers and a heavy overdose of anything psychedelic, and what you get is someone who ought to be selling records as fast as The Oh Sees and Ty Segall combined.
